Output f43a313f73ffe4342def464a6005650007971ac16c22a9507f9cea0488d85e62:10

value
10840000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d307be574d13c541f86a36224fe3662686f6e7e OP_EQUALVERIFY OP_CHECKSIG
address
1JFLnyutt71J8MxhxfqoSJUG7VzD688233
transaction
f43a313f73ffe4342def464a6005650007971ac16c22a9507f9cea0488d85e62
spent
true